WebThe Kindergarten of Eden Question: Does competition distort pure effort? Or What ever happened to the Olympic ideal? Competing is integral to many games. Pitting one team or one individual against another to achieve a goal creates many of our most beloved games. I.e., baseball, tennis, football, etc. and we, as audience glorify the players.
